FAQs for finding summer camps near you in Kensington, MD
What are the benefits of attending summer camp near me in Kensington, MD?
Summer camps near you in Kensington, MD can be extremely beneficial for children. They offer a summer worth of activities that are structured, educational, and recreational. Through summer camp, kids get to develop life skills essential for personal development, such as conflict resolution and team building. Summer camps also facilitate access to experts in various fields including music, art, technology, and adventure activities. Beyond those traditional summer camp experiences, summer camps create long lasting friendships and a supportive community where participants can gain self-confidence and build independence. Aside from the social benefits of summer camp, children will also be provided with physical activity options which promote emotional wellbeing while aiding in supplementing academic education during summer vacation.

Summer camp costs vary widely based on the type of camp, length of stay, location, and other factors. Day camps tend to cost less than overnight ones that are located farther away from home. Prices for summer camps can range anywhere from several hundred dollars to a few thousand. In addition to the cost of tuition, there may also be fees for activities and materials. Before signing up, it is important to research what is covered by the fee and what you will need to pay extra for.
